Ponoka RCMP investigate shooting

May 5, 2023
Ponoka, Alberta

News release

On May 4, 2023, at 2:56 a.m., Ponoka RCMP received a report of a shooting that occurred at or near 57 Avenue in Ponoka. Upon arrival, officers located a 39-year-old individual, a resident of Ponoka, with what appeared to be a gun shot wound. The victim was taken to hospital where they remain in critical but stable condition.

Although early in the investigation, RCMP believe this may have been a targeted attack.

Police believe that the suspect(s) were in a vehicle of unknown description.
